Secrets of New Haven Walking Tour

There’s a lot to New Haven that you probably don’t know.

For example, six-feet-under the grass of New Haven Green remains one of the earliest and largest cemeteries in Connecticut.

One block West is home to the most infamous secret society in the country.

Two blocks South you’ll find the theater district which has a long and haunted history.

And three blocks North you’ll be at the gates to a cemetery home to the likes of Webster, Yale, and many other famous Americans.
